def test_bool(self): b = Bool() for v in self.bools: b.validate(v) for v in self.not_bools: with self.assertRaises(TypeError): b.validate(v) self.assertEqual(repr(b), '<Boolean>')
def test_bool(): b = Bool() for v in BOOLS: b.validate(v) for v in NOTBOOLS: with pytest.raises(TypeError): b.validate(v) assert repr(b) == '<Boolean>'
def test_valid_values(self): val = Bool() for vval in val.valid_values: val.validate(vval)
def test_valid_bool_values(): val = Bool() for vval in val.valid_values: val.validate(vval)
def test_valid_values(self): val = Bool() val.validate(val.valid_values[0])